Stay in the Loop
New notification settings are now available.
They've also been updated so you'll now receive an email notification whenever someone replies to one of your posts.
The goal is to make conversations easier to follow without requiring you to constantly check the site.
As notification settings continue to evolve, you'll have even more control over how and when you'd like to hear from the community.
A More Polished Experience
You may notice the site looks a little different.
I've completed another visual pass across the platform to make everything feel more consistent.
Buttons, toggles, switches, and other interface elements have all been updated to create a cleaner, more uniform experience.
These may seem like small changes individually, but together they make the platform feel much more cohesive.
I've also upgraded the post editor, giving you more formatting options and better spacing so it's easier to write posts that are organized, readable, and expressive.
